Akwa-Ibom born songstress, F3line (Etietop Bassey Utin), has unveiled her highly anticipated single, “Only You,” a mesmerizing blend of Afropop and R&B that delves into the intoxicating realm of instant attraction and magnetic connections.
From penning her first song at the tender age of 10, F3line’s musical journey has been one of undeniable destiny. Inspired by her love for cats, her stage name reflects the agility and resilience that propelled her through diverse career paths, culminating in a pivotal encounter with Jimmi Abduls, which ignited her music career.
“Only You” is a testament to F3line’s artistry, where intimate lyrics, such as “I came for you and only you,” intertwine seamlessly with lush Afropop production. Her vocals effortlessly navigate between confident flirtation and vulnerable admission, masterfully encapsulating the electric tension of a burgeoning attraction.
“This song is all about that magnetic connection—you walk into a place, and there’s only one person you have your eyes on,” F3line explains, shedding light on the track’s inspiration. “It’s about being fully present in that moment and allowing the music to completely take over.”
